Our provisional, expected to be final, dates for next year, 2026 have been announced. They are:
April 19th Test Day.
2nd and 3rd May
23rd and 24th May – British Hill Climb Championship
13th and 14th June
4th and 5th July
1st and 2nd August
29th and 30th August
School Dates will be announced

The 2025 Turbo Dynamics Gurston Down Championship is now more than half way through and things have significantly changed since earlier in the year.
There were some good performances in each of the twelve rounds completed. The early August meeting, with four more rounds will probably bring some m ore claity to the linkely contenders at the later August meeting.
The current leader is Clive Skipper in the Caterham 231.65 points. But the points margin is very small. Clive’s lead over Tim Pitfield is just over 3 points. Jim White is third by just 0.01 points.
Take a look at the table, there are many drivers with a chance of taking the Championship or being one of the top three.

The 2025 Online Cleaning Technology BARC SW Top Ten Challenge has got off to an interesting start and things have moved on since the last report.
The first six rounds saw some great performances and changes in the leader board after almost every run. With just four rounds remaining and drops scores to be accounted for, it may well be down to the last weekend at the end of August.
The current leader is Ben Bonfield in the Jedi, leads with 51 points.

Second is Mark Crookall with 40 points. His maiden Challenge win on Sunday 6th July puts him in a great place for the rest of the season.

Third is Terry Graves in the Gould on 35 points.

There are some important changes to Competition Car Log Books at the end of 2025.
All Competition Car Log Books will expire on the 31st December 2025. So you will need to get a Vehicle Passport for the 2026 season. These can be obtained from any MSUK scrutineer who can issue Vehicle Passports. For more information, check the NCRs or contact one of our scrutineering team at one of our next meetings.
Vehicle Passports expire on the date shown on each individual passport.
The relevant parts of the NCRs are Ch.7 App.1 Art.1.7 and Art.1.8, a summary of which can be found below in the attached document.
